MEAT COMPANY FUSION

Messrs N elson Brothers' meat works a£ Tomoana (Hawkes Bay), and Taruhera (Gisborne), which wei-e recently reported eold, were, it appears, purchased by JVlesats. Vestey Brothers, of" the Union Cold. Storage, trading in New Zealand, as W. and B. Fletcher, Ltd., '■with1 head office in Auckland. The price payable is £600,000, represented as to £500,000 by 6 per cent, mortj gages, allocated among the difiefent properties, and as to £100,000 by 6 per cent, preference shares in the Union Cold Storage Company, Ltd. Messrs. Nelson Brothers are also interested ini the Colonial Consignment and Distributing Coompany to the extent of £224,----.495 of the £225,000 ordinary shares of the company.
